Winsor & Newton Gouache Paint
More opaque than watercolors, if you're looking for something thicker but still water soluble!
VIEW HERE!

Holbein Acrylic Gouache Paint
Another great gouache paint! These gems are acrylic gouache, which is permanent + cannot be reactivated with water.
